摘要

The concept design of a novel robotic system consists of a flotilla of robots and double transmission system is introduced in preparation of a human mission to the planet. One main robot carrying the scientific and operating instruments, four smaller ones scanning for mapping makes a redundant system. Wheels for plane notion plus legs let robots move quickly and overtake obstacles. Tele-control and independent autonomous movements were designed. Equipped with macroand nanosensors, the flotilla has a strong sensor system. The detection system positioned at the centre of the main robot allows the robot to sample and analyze. Several advances of the design were lists at last.
